Description
To introduce students to the main types of written
communication in welfare work.

To equip students with effective written
communication skills.

To allow students to practise written communication
skills in a variety of welfare contexts.

Evidence Guide
Internal Assessment 100%

Using role-plays and case studies, students should
be given time in class to practise their written
communication skills.

Agency Record 20%

Students are required to:

- develop a recording system for client contact and data
collection

- implement that system in an agency-setting, using a
role-play in class, which is compatible with current State and Commonwealth
programs.

Letter-Writing 30%

Using detailed case studies, students are required
to write letters to:

- a trust fund (e.g. The Wearne Trust) requesting financial
assistance for a client

- a creditor negotiating a debt on behalf of a client.

Social History 40%

Using detailed case studies, students are required
to prepare:

- a general social history of a client

- a specific social history to be used as a court report.

Referral 10%

Through the use of a role-play in class, students
must write a referral letter for a client to an
appropriate agency/organisation.
